Literature summary extracted from

  • Sun, D.F.; Weng, Y.R.; Chen, Y.X.; Lu, R.; Wang, X.; Fang, J.Y.
    Knock-down of methylenetetrahydrofolate reductase reduces gastric cancer cell survival: An in vitro study (2008), Cell Biol. Int., 32, 879-887.
    View publication on PubMed

Application

EC Number Application Comment Organism
1.5.1.20 medicine MTHFR inhibition may be a novel anticancer approach Homo sapiens

Inhibitors

EC Number Inhibitors Comment Organism Structure
1.5.1.20 additional information inhibiting MTHFR with either antisense or siRNA decreases the viability of methionine-dependent transformed gastric cancer cells Homo sapiens
